Introduction to Epson ScanSmart

What is Epson ScanSmart?

Epson ScanSmart is a scanning application that allows you to quickly scan, save, and share documents and photos. It comes equipped with features like automatic text recognition (OCR), cloud storage integration, and easy file management, making it ideal for both home and office use.

Key Features:
  • Simple interface for scanning and saving documents.
  • Integration with cloud services like Google Drive, Dropbox, and OneDrive.
  • Automatic text recognition for searchable PDFs.
  • Email and file-sharing capabilities directly from the software.

Step 1: Downloading and Installing Epson ScanSmart

Before you can use the software, you'll need to download and install it on your computer.

Downloading Epson ScanSmart:
  1. Visit the Epson Website:
    • Go to the official Epson website at www.epson.com and search for your printer or scanner model.
    • Navigate to the Drivers and Downloads section of your printer or scanner model's page.
  2. Select the Correct Version:
    • Choose the operating system (Windows or macOS) that corresponds to your computer.
    • Look for Epson ScanSmart under the software section and click Download.
  3. Install the Software:
    • Once the download is complete, open the installation file.
    •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the installation process.
    • After installation, the software will launch automatically.

Step 2: Setting Up Epson ScanSmart

Once installed, you'll need to set up Epson ScanSmart to work with your Epson scanner or all-in-one printer.

Connecting Your Printer/Scanner:
  1. Ensure the Printer/Scanner is Powered On:
    • Turn on your Epson printer or scanner and ensure it is connected to your computer, either via USB or Wi-Fi.
  2. Open Epson ScanSmart:
    • Open the Epson ScanSmart application from your desktop or start menu.
    • The software will automatically detect any connected Epson devices. If it does not, ensure your device drivers are installed properly.
  3. Select Your Device:
    • Once detected, select your Epson printer or scanner from the list of available devices.
    • Click Next to confirm the device and proceed with setup.

Step 3: Basic Scanning with Epson ScanSmart

Epson ScanSmart makes scanning simple with its intuitive interface. Here’s how you can perform a basic scan.

Scanning Documents and Photos:
  1. Place the Document:
    • Open the scanner lid and place the document or photo face down on the scanning bed. For multi-page documents, you can use the Automatic Document Feeder (ADF), if your device has one.
  2. Select the Scan Mode:
    • In the Epson ScanSmart interface, click on Scan. You’ll be prompted to choose between Document or Photo scanning.
    • For basic scanning, select the option that matches what you're scanning.
  3. Adjust the Scan Settings (Optional):
    • You can adjust settings like Resolution (DPI), Color Mode (Black and White, Color), and File Format (PDF, JPEG, TIFF) based on your needs.
    • If scanning a document, you can also enable OCR (Optical Character Recognition) to make the document searchable.
  4. Start Scanning:
    • Click Scan to start the scanning process. The scanned image or document will appear on the screen once complete.
  5. Review and Save:
    • Review the scanned file in the preview window. If everything looks good, click Save.
    • Choose a file format (PDF, JPEG, PNG) and select the location where you want to save the file on your computer.
    • You can also rename the file before saving it.

Step 4: Advanced Scanning Features in Epson ScanSmart

Epson ScanSmart offers advanced features that allow you to scan and manage documents more efficiently.

1. Multi-Page Scanning into a Single PDF:

For scanning multi-page documents into one continuous PDF file:

  1. Use the ADF: If your printer has an Automatic Document Feeder, load the multiple pages into the ADF.
  2. Enable Multi-Page Scanning: In the scan settings, choose the option to scan multiple pages into one PDF.
  3. Start the Scan: Once scanning is complete, all pages will be compiled into a single PDF.
2. Automatic Text Recognition (OCR):

Epson ScanSmart's OCR feature converts scanned text into editable and searchable PDFs or Word documents.

  1. Enable OCR: When scanning a document, select the OCR option in the settings.
  2. Choose Output Format: After scanning, you can save the file as a searchable PDF or editable text format like Microsoft Word.
  3. Edit Text: The OCR software will analyze the scanned image and convert any recognizable text into editable text. You can review and edit the output before saving.
3. Cloud Integration:

Epson ScanSmart allows you to save scanned documents directly to cloud services like Google Drive, Dropbox, or OneDrive.

  1. Connect to Cloud Services:
    • In the ScanSmart interface, click Save and select Cloud Storage.
    • Log in to your cloud account, and authorize the Epson ScanSmart app to access your cloud storage.
  2. Save to Cloud:
    • After scanning, you can choose to save your document directly to a cloud folder for easy access from any device.
4. Email Scanned Documents:
  1. Send Scanned Files via Email:
    • After scanning a document, click the Email button in the interface.
    • The software will attach the file to a new email in your default email application.
  2. Choose File Format: You can select whether to send the file as a PDF, JPEG, or other formats before emailing.

Step 5: Organizing and Managing Scanned Documents

Once you’ve scanned your documents, Epson ScanSmart makes it easy to organize and manage them.

1. File Naming and Organization:
  1. Rename Files: After scanning, you can easily rename your files in the preview screen before saving them.
  2. Create Folders: Organize your scanned documents by creating specific folders within Epson ScanSmart. This can help you keep documents like receipts, invoices, or photos in separate, easy-to-access locations.
2. Searchable PDFs:

When you enable OCR for your scanned documents, the software automatically creates searchable PDFs. This makes it easy to find specific text within a large document using the Search function in PDF viewers like Adobe Reader.

Step 6: Troubleshooting Epson ScanSmart

If you encounter any issues while using Epson ScanSmart, here are some common problems and solutions:

1. Printer/Scanner Not Detected:
  • Check Connection: Ensure that the printer or scanner is properly connected to your computer, either through a USB cable or Wi-Fi.
  • Update Drivers: Go to the Epson website and check for driver updates for your specific printer or scanner model.
  • Restart Devices: Restart both the printer/scanner and your computer to refresh the connection.
2. Scan Quality Issues:
  • Adjust Resolution: If your scans appear blurry or pixelated, try increasing the resolution (DPI) in the scan settings.
  • Clean the Scanner Bed: Dust or smudges on the scanner glass can cause poor scan quality. Clean the glass with a microfiber cloth and try scanning again.
3. OCR Not Working Correctly:
  • Clear Text and Font: Ensure the document you’re scanning has clear, legible text. OCR works best with typed, printed text rather than handwritten notes.
  • Increase Resolution: Scanning at a higher DPI can improve OCR accuracy, especially for small fonts or detailed documents.

Step 7: Updating Epson ScanSmart Software

Epson periodically releases updates for ScanSmart to improve performance and add new features. To ensure you're using the latest version:

  1. Check for Updates:
    • Open Epson ScanSmart and go to Help > Check for Updates.
    • If an update is available, follow the on-screen instructions to download and install it.
  2. Enable Automatic Updates:
    • In the settings menu, you can choose to enable automatic updates, ensuring your software stays current without manual intervention.

FAQ: Epson ScanSmart Software Co

1. What is Epson ScanSmart?

Epson ScanSmart is a software designed to simplify the process of scanning documents, photos, and other materials. It provides an intuitive interface for saving, organizing, and sharing your scanned files and includes features like Optical Character Recognition (OCR), cloud storage integration, and direct emailing of scanned documents.

2. Which Epson printers and scanners are compatible with ScanSmart?

Epson ScanSmart is compatible with most Epson all-in-one printers and dedicated scanners. You can verify compatibility by visiting the Epson website, selecting your device model, and checking if Epson ScanSmart is listed in the software downloads section.

3. How do I download and install Epson ScanSmart?
  1. Visit the official Epson website and navigate to your printer or scanner model's Drivers & Downloads section.
  2. Select your operating system (Windows or macOS).
  3. Download the Epson ScanSmart software and follow the on-screen installation instructions.
4. What operating systems support Epson ScanSmart?

Epson ScanSmart is compatible with Windows (Windows 7 and later) and macOS (macOS 10.12 and later). Check your printer or scanner model for specific operating system compatibility.

5. Can I scan multiple pages into one PDF with ScanSmart?

Yes, you can scan multi-page documents into a single PDF file. Use the Automatic Document Feeder (ADF) on your Epson device (if available) or scan pages individually, and select the option to combine all pages into one PDF file during the saving process.

6. How does Optical Character Recognition (OCR) work in ScanSmart?

OCR allows you to convert scanned documents into searchable and editable text. To use OCR:

  1. Enable OCR in the scan settings before starting the scan.
  2. After scanning, save the document as a Searchable PDF or an editable text file (e.g., Word).
7. Can I save scanned files directly to cloud storage?

Yes, Epson ScanSmart integrates with cloud services such as Google Drive, Dropbox, and OneDrive. After scanning, choose Save to Cloud and log into your cloud account to save your files directly to your desired cloud storage location.

8. How do I send scanned documents via email using ScanSmart?

After scanning a document, click the Email button in the ScanSmart interface. This will open your default email client with the scanned document attached. Choose the file format (PDF, JPEG, etc.) before sending.

9. What file formats can I save my scanned documents in?

You can save scanned documents in a variety of file formats, including:

  • PDF (standard and searchable)
  • JPEG
  • PNG
  • TIFF
  • Word Document (with OCR enabled)
10. Why is my Epson printer or scanner not detected by ScanSmart?

If ScanSmart cannot detect your device, try the following:

  • Ensure that your printer/scanner is powered on and properly connected to your computer via USB or Wi-Fi.
  • Check that the drivers for your device are installed and up-to-date.
  • Restart your printer/scanner and your computer.
  • Verify that your device is connected to the same Wi-Fi network as your computer (for wireless scanning).
11. How do I adjust the scan resolution?

In the Epson ScanSmart interface, click on Settings before starting your scan. Here, you can adjust the resolution (DPI), with higher DPI settings resulting in more detailed scans but larger file sizes. Common DPI options include 150, 300, 600, and 1200 DPI.

12. What should I do if my scans appear blurry or distorted?
  • Clean the scanner bed with a microfiber cloth to remove dust or smudges.
  • Adjust the DPI settings to a higher resolution for clearer scans.
  • Ensure that the document is placed flat on the scanner bed or properly aligned in the Automatic Document Feeder (ADF).
13. How do I enable automatic updates for ScanSmart?

You can enable automatic updates by going to Settings in the ScanSmart interface and selecting the option for Automatic Updates. This ensures that your software is always up-to-date with the latest features and security improvements.

14. Can I scan directly to an editable Word document?

Yes, if you enable OCR during scanning, ScanSmart allows you to save your scanned document directly as an editable Microsoft Word file.

15. Why are some characters missing or incorrect in OCR-scanned documents?

OCR works best with printed, clear text. If characters are missing or incorrect:

  • Increase the scan resolution to at least 300 DPI or higher for better text recognition.
  • Ensure the text is legible and well-contrasted against the background.
  • For handwritten documents, OCR may not work accurately.
16. What should I do if Epson ScanSmart crashes or freezes?

If the software crashes or freezes:

  • Ensure that your computer meets the system requirements for Epson ScanSmart.
  • Check if the software is up-to-date. If not, update it.
  • Restart your computer and reopen the software.
  • Reinstall ScanSmart if the issue persists.
17. How do I troubleshoot poor scan quality in ScanSmart?

If your scans are of poor quality:

  • Adjust the Scan Resolution in settings to a higher DPI.
  • Clean the scanner bed and remove any dust or smudges.
  • Ensure that the document is properly aligned on the scanner bed or in the ADF.
18. Can I scan both sides of a page (duplex scanning)?

Yes, if your Epson scanner or printer has duplex scanning capabilities, you can scan both sides of a document. In the scan settings, select the Duplex Scan option to scan both sides of the page automatically.

19. Can I organize and rename files within Epson ScanSmart?

Yes, after scanning, you can rename files before saving them. You can also create folders within the software to organize your scanned files, making it easy to manage large volumes of documents.

20. How do I uninstall Epson ScanSmart from my computer?

To uninstall Epson ScanSmart:

  • On Windows: Go to Control Panel > Programs > Uninstall a Program, find Epson ScanSmart, and click Uninstall.
  • On macOS: Drag the Epson ScanSmart application from the Applications folder to the Trash, then empty the Trash.
